7 Example Sentences Showcasing the Meaning of 'Wipe The Slate Clean'

In the world of art restoration, experts aim to wipe the slate clean, removing centuries-old grime to reveal the true beauty of a painting.

After a heated debate, the politicians decided to wipe the slate clean and collaborate for the common good.

In the realm of personal development, mindfulness practices help individuals wipe the slate clean and live in the present moment.

In the business world, it's essential to wipe the slate clean at the start of a new fiscal year, setting new goals and strategies.

The therapist advised her client to wipe the slate clean emotionally, letting go of past grievances and starting a journey of healing.

Environmental activists call for nations to wipe the slate clean in terms of carbon emissions and work towards a sustainable future.

In the self-help workshop, participants were guided to wipe the slate clean of negative self-perceptions and embrace self-love.
